| Obverse description | Central field occupied by a multi-line Arabic legend in relief, arranged within a decorative inner cartouche or arc bordered by a prominent pellet-and-line border. The inscription in Naskh-style script reads the royal titulature of the khan. The flan is irregular and slightly convex, typical of hammered Golden Horde coinage, with the legend occasionally running off the flan edge due to the small module relative to the die. |
